Transaction 35a4e3761b51d21db4cb16858004d0dda494c8330f1172bcc2e04cfa5fb2bf83

1 Input
2 Outputs
  • 35a4e3761b51d21db4cb16858004d0dda494c8330f1172bcc2e04cfa5fb2bf83:0
  • value  180000000
    address  32i2ABfPezGmjfpbRPSM3bSSBAXPjh59nd
  • 35a4e3761b51d21db4cb16858004d0dda494c8330f1172bcc2e04cfa5fb2bf83:1
  • value  519981698
    address  1NrpBQW7G1sosTooKSEfqhJgbiC1Aihpdo